Benjamin Biegel
About
Benjamin Biegel has authored 19 papers that have received a total of 419 indexed citations.
This includes 17 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ering, 11 papers in Control and Systems Engineering and 2 papers in Information Systems. The topics of these papers are Smart Grid Energy Management (15 papers), Microgrid Control and Optimization (8 papers) and Integrated Energy Systems Optimization (4 papers). Benjamin Biegel is often cited by papers focused on Smart Grid Energy Management (15 papers), Microgrid Control and Optimization (8 papers) and Integrated Energy Systems Optimization (4 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Denmark, Germany and Croatia. Benjamin Biegel's co-authors include Jakob Stoustrup, Palle Andersen, Lars Henrik Hansen, Jan Dimon Bendtsen and Sebastian Baltes and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the IEEE, Energy and IEEE Transactions on Smart Grid.
